Menomonee Falls lost against Arrowhead back in October of 2024 and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Saturday. The Phoenix took a 2-0 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Warhawks. The Phoenix have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back matches.
While Menomonee Falls was not able to win a set, they sure kept things interesting: every set was decided by exactly two points. The final score came out to 32-30, 32-30.
Daniel Poulakos paced Menomonee Falls' offense, picking up seven kills. Poulakos got some help from Ben Kuhn and his 13 assists. Brayden Rivera controlled things from the service line, finishing with four aces.
Arrowhead found their leader in sophomore Jackson Bertolli, who had 12 digs and three assists.
Menomonee Falls' loss dropped their record down to 16-13. As for Arrowhead,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won eight of their last nine matches. That's provided a massive bump to their 17-10 record this season.
Menomonee Falls did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next contest, a 2-0 defeat against Waukesha West on the 4th. As for Arrowhead, they have also already played their next matchup, a 2-1 victory against Indian Trail on the 4th.
